Literature summary for 3.4.21.4 extracted from

  • Knecht, W.; Cottrell, G.S.; Amadesi, S.; Mohlin, J.; Skaregaerde, A.; Gedda, K.; Peterson, A.; Chapman, K.; Hollenberg, M.D.; Vergnolle, N.; Bunnett, N.W.
    Trypsin IV or mesotrypsin and p23 cleave protease-activated receptors 1 and 2 to induce inflammation and hyperalgesia (2007), J. Biol. Chem., 282, 26089-26100.
